LOS ANGELES, Aug. 4 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- Reading
International, Inc. (AMEX:RDIAMEX:andAMEX:RDIB) announced today the
appointment of Jay S. Laifman, Esq. as its General Counsel and
Chief Legal Officer. (Logo:
http://www.newscom.com/cgi-bin/prnh/20030403/LATH058LOGO ) Mr.
Laifman comes to Reading from Countrywide Financial Corporation,
where he was Deputy General Counsel, overseeing and handling legal
services for corporate real estate, human resources, intellectual
property, corporate contracts and charitable giving. Prior to that,
Mr. Laifman was with Pircher, Nichols & Meeks, focusing
primarily on real estate matters, including purchases, sales,
leases, financings, joint ventures, construction, management,
governmental relations and litigation. Mr. Laifman graduated in
1985 from the University of California at Santa Cruz with a B.A.
degree in Computer and Information Sciences and Legal Studies and
thereafter received his J.D. in 1988 from Hastings College of the
Law. About Reading International, Inc. Reading International
(http://www.readingrdi.com/) is in the business of owning and
operating cinemas and developing, owning and operating real estate
assets. Our business consists primarily of: -- the development,
ownership and operation of multiplex cinemas in the United States,
Australia and New Zealand; and -- the development, ownership and
operation of retail and commercial real estate in Australia, New
Zealand and the United States, including entertainment-themed
retail centers ("ETRC") in Australia and New Zealand and live
theater assets in Manhattan and Chicago in the United States.
Reading manages its worldwide cinema business under various
different brands: -- in the United States, under the -- Reading
brand, -- Angelika Film Center brand
(http://angelikafilmcenter.com/), -- Consolidated Theatres brand
(http://www.consolidatedtheatres.com/), and -- City Cinemas brand;
-- in Australia, under the Reading brand
(http://www.readingcinemas.com.au/); and -- in New Zealand, under
the -- Reading (http://www.readingcinemas.co.nz/) and -- Rialto
(http://www.rialto.co.nz/) brands. Contact Information: Reading
